The special legislative session called this week by Governor Cuomo has ended with an agreement on a Lake Ontario flood relief package and a number of downstate issues that had been holding up some key agreements.

The agreements in the legislature do include critical sales tax extenders for county governments, although Governor Andrew Cuomo and the Assembly favored dealing only with Mayoral Control of New York City Schools. The State Senate pushed for a global bill that included the the one-penny addition on the sales tax that funds 53 local county governments.

That measure was approved, although Cuomo said it should wait until states know what Congressional health care legislation will do with medicaid funding.
